How they compare

Haiti currently reports 45.4% against 21.9% in Least developed countries, a difference of 23.5%.

That makes Haiti's figure about 2.1 times Least developed countries's.

Across all 5 years both countries report, Haiti has been ahead every year.

Haiti ranks 3rd and Least developed countries ranks 3rd of 125 countries.

Haiti has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Haiti Least developed countries Difference Ahead
2010s 48.8% 19.5% 29.3% Haiti
2020s 44.0% 21.4% 22.6% Haiti

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The percentage of people in the population who live in households classified as severely food insecure. A household is classified as severely food insecure when at least one adult in the household has reported to have been exposed, at times during the year, to several of the most severe experiences described in the FIES questions, such as to have been forced to reduce the quantity of the food, to have skipped meals, having gone hungry, or having to go for a whole day without eating because of a lack of money or other resources.
